Minutemen Lose, 4-3 | St. Louis beat Boston on the strength of starting pitcher Steve Madden's fine effort. The right-hander led his team to a win, 4-3. Boston has now lost 4 straight.
St. Louis took the lead, 4-2, on Danny Davis's 12th home run of the season. The solo home run came off Boston pitcher Otey Stevens in the top of the eighth.
"We'll relax tonight and get back after it tomorrow," Madden said after the game. | |
